It Is the Little Things That Mean So Much

Tuesday, March 18th, 2008
I am often reminded of the musical "The Sound of Music" when I think about the little things that mean so much. I envision Julie Andrews twirling around on top of the mountain singing "My Favorite Things." As she belts out, "raindrops on roses and whiskers on kittens, bright copper kettles and warm woolen mittens..." I ponder on the simplicity of those words and the image and feelings they create.

Eliot Spitzer - A Lesson For All Of Us

Tuesday, March 18th, 2008
The Spitzer tornado has kept the media and political circles busy for the last few days. Mr. Spitzer's fall from grace has wider implications than his immediate legal and personal troubles. Each interest group has an interpretation of Mr. Spitzer's downfall, which sometimes makes it difficult to extract a clear lesson from the tragedy. I believe there are lessons each of us can learn from this tragedy for our own personal journeys.
